It's been a year in the making but two half-siblings from different sides of Canada met for the first time this week in Nova Scotia after DNA matched them together as family.

Debby Martin, 74, says she always had suspicions she may have not been the biological child of her parents. And after sending a DNA sample to an online ancestry website, Ancestry.com, her suspicions were confirmed. On Thursday, she met her half-sibling Colin Brown.

"I was so happy to see him and that he was real," she said. "He was there. He was mine."

Amber Fryday was at the airport to take in the emotional scene and find out how the family is feeling.
